Transaction 523cc425a31870043af232642044745f882488701c513bf553584246b929d2e8
2 Input
2 Outputs
- 523cc425a31870043af232642044745f882488701c513bf553584246b929d2e8:0
- 523cc425a31870043af232642044745f882488701c513bf553584246b929d2e8:1
value 15282600
address 1KNWhinPHjJnzbM9dKmdc5k2r2CZxt6evw
value 100000000
address 14xzv4EHTd8omnw8bfyLFGhAquWXJbeX6C